Common questions
Is Okja a movie about a young girl saving an animal?
Yes, Okja is a 2017 film directed by Bong Joon Ho that follows a young girl named Mija. She risks everything to prevent a powerful, multi-national company from kidnapping her best friend, a massive animal named Okja.
